Applications for the Civil Police of Ceará Contest Open in May; New Career Requires Higher Education and Will Be Organized by Funece. Details of the Notice Will Be Released in the Official State Gazette.

The official notice for the PC CE contest will be published this Tuesday, April 15, as announced by the Governor of the State of Ceará, Elmano Freitas. The Civil Police contest will offer 500 positions for the role of investigative officer, a new career created in December 2024, requiring a higher education degree in any field of study.

Applications for the contest will be open from May 2 to May 16 through the website of the Fundação Universidade Estadual do Ceará (Funece), which will be responsible for organizing the selection process. It is expected that the complete notice, with all details about the syllabus and evaluation stages, will be made available tonight in the Official State Gazette.

The Civil Police Contest of Ceará Will Have a Reserve List

In addition to the 500 immediate vacancies, the PC CE contest also anticipates the formation of a reserve list with up to one thousand additional positions, which may be filled according to the need and the budget availability of the State. According to the governor, there is an intention to summon more candidates over time.

“There are 500 vacancies, but we want to call even more. This will depend on our financial availability”, said Elmano Freitas on social media.

The new role of police investigative officer arose from the unification of the former positions of inspector and clerk, as part of adapting state legislation to the new General Law of Civil Police. The measure aims to provide more agility and flexibility to the actions of public security servers.

What Does a Police Investigative Officer Do

The police investigative officer is the professional responsible for directly acting in criminal investigations, assisting the police chief in diligences and evidence collection. Among the duties of the position are:

  • Carrying out intelligence actions and field investigations;
  • Executing legal mandates, such as searches and arrests;
  • Producing technical reports and police documents;
  • Operating security and police management systems;
  • Collaborating in integrated actions with other public security bodies.

The position requires discretion, analytical capacity, physical and emotional preparedness, as well as technical and legal knowledge for compliance with laws and police procedures.

Stages of the Selection Process

According to the state government, candidates enrolled in the Civil Police contest of Ceará will be evaluated through the following stages:

  • Objective Test;
  • Subjective Test;
  • Physical Aptitude Test (TAF);
  • Psychological Evaluation;
  • Social Investigation;
  • Training and Professional Development Course.

The objective and subjective tests will be held on the same day. The syllabus for these evaluations will be detailed in the notice that will be published in the Official Gazette later this Tuesday. The expectation, according to the contract signed with the organizing body, is that around 55,000 candidates will participate in the selection.

Salary and Requirements for the Position

The position of police investigative officer requires a complete higher education degree in any area. The initial remuneration reported by the government is R$ 6,732.71, in addition to benefits provided for public servants of the state.
